What are they for ...

A favicon is used in your browser. It appears in the field beside you are seeing the adress URL (depends a bit on what browser you are using). It is also stored if you add an URL as bookmark to your browser, then you will see it besides the bookmark. And it's used beside the open tabs in the browser also.
